Let’s work backwards and first consider the definition of the verb ‘Leap’:
Leap, n. 1. The act of leaping, or the space passed by leaping; a jump; a spring; a bound1.
Most people would define a leap as the act of physically jumping. Though, the word in modern language infers a larger-than-normal jump.
A leap could be a startled response caused by great fear as in, “He leapt from the train just in time!”
Or, in a state of excitement, you might “Leap at the chance!” to be on a TV show.
From a scientific point of view, a ‘quantum leap’ is a paradigm shift which occurs when currently accepted principles are replaced by new insights.
Examples would include the ideas of Copernicus (the Earth revolving around the Sun), Newton (Theory of Gravity) and Einstein (Theory of Relativity). Their leaps of genius and intuitive observations have changed the world.
Even Neil Armstrong, the first man to walk on the moon, differentiated between a “small step for man” and a “giant leap for mankind!”
Thus, a “leap” can represent a major opportunity for change in your life.
Although the term can also bear a negative connotation such as, “He leapt to a conclusion before listening to me.” In this case, an over-reactive neural net made a swift, yet often incorrect, decision.
